AMSOIL Synthetic Marine Gear Lube is an exclusive AMSOIL formulation
of synthetic base oils and high-performance additives that addresses
the specific concerns of marine applications. It is fortified with extreme-pressure
(EP) additives for superior protection of fast-accelerating,
high-torque/horsepower engines. It protects against shock loading from
cavitation of heavily loaded engines.
AMSOIL Synthetic Marine Gear Lube is water resistant. It maintains
extreme-pressure protection even when contaminated with as much
as 10 percent water. It promotes longer seal life to help prevent water
contamination**. AMSOIL Synthetic Marine Gear Lube is designed to
prevent rust and is compatible with aluminum, copper and brass alloys.

The Falex Procedure is a measurement of a gear lube's extreme-pressure and
anti-wear properties. A high value in the Falex Extreme-Pressure Test relates to extra
extreme-pressure protection. AMSOIL Synthetic Marine Gear Lube provides extreme-pressure
protection and is highly resistant to the effects of water contamination.
The presence of foam in a lubricant disrupts the oil film and promotes wear. Water
contamination can increase the likelihood of foaming. Industry-standard testing
demonstrates zero foam in both new and water-contaminated AMSOIL Synthetic
Marine Gear Lube.

APPLICATIONS
Use in fresh- and saltwater applications that require 75W-90 or
80W-90 gear lube and any of the specifications listed below,
including lower units made by Mercury/Mariner*, Johnson/Evinrude*, Bombardier*, Honda*, Yamaha*, Suzuki*, Force/US Marine*, Nissan*, Tohatsu* and Harbormaster*; sterndrives
made by Mercruiser-Bravo*, OMC/Bombardier, Volvo-Penta*,
Yanmar*, Konrad* and Marine Drive Systems*; V-drives made
by Casale & Menkins*; bow thrusters made by Harbormaster
Marine*; and transmissions made by ZF Marine Transmission*.
• API GL-4, GL-5
